About the Client

Founded in 1937, Pet Alliance of Greater Orlando (PAGO) is the state’s oldest and largest animal welfare agency. Originally operating as the Orlando Humane Society, the organization has a dedicated focus on the welfare and well-being of animals in Central Florida. As the “go-to” experts in Greater Orlando, they do incredible things for dogs and cats and the people who love them.

Our relationship with PAGO began with promoting its name change from the SPCA to Pet Alliance of Greater Orlando and has grown into so much more. Locally there was much confusion with the name SPCA, leading us to help the organization with a brand refresh and themed campaigns that would clarify its brand position in Central Florida. From public awareness campaigns and social marketing to fundraising videos and public relations, we are proud to partner with this incredible organization and bring it's heartwarming stories to light.

Socially Adorable

One of the first steps we took to help PAGO was getting them set up on social media with an organic calendar and content strategy. Each week, they would feature adoptable animals in the shelter, keeping them updated and giving them a better chance of being adopted.


PAGO Unleashed

Upon rebranding to Pet Alliance of Greater Orlando, the organization wanted a feel-good awareness campaign that would generate more adoptions for the shelter. This widespread multimedia campaign included print and digital ads, social marketing, print collateral, billboards, public relations and vehicle wraps.

Let’s Have a Ball

Throughout the years, we’ve assisted PAGO with its various awareness and fundraising events, including Paws in the Park, the Humane Heroes Luncheon and its annual fundraising gala, Furball.



It’s All for a Good Paws

For PAGO, getting the word out is crucial for many of its programs and initiatives. For the launch of its pet registry program, we enacted public relations efforts that elicited tremendous news coverage. In addition, we promoted PAGO’s mobile vet unit in an effort to keep the animal homeless population down.
